### Runbook: Squatwatch scanner

Welcome aboard! Squatwatch scans our internal package registry for names suspiciously close to popular public packages. It runs hourly; if it flags something, quarantine first, ask questions later — false positives are cheap, compromised builds aren't. Logs live on the scanner host under the usual service directory. Before running it manually, load the following configuration values.

service settings:
[casax]
port = 6379
team = rusir
host = casax.zemvarhq.corp
region = outer-4
access_code = ac_9808ce
timeout_ms = 1500

# Build Provenance: Cron to Flowhawk Migration

All nightly jobs formerly on the Marlbeck cron host now run in Flowhawk pipelines. Each pipeline stamps its artifacts with the run that produced them, so future maintainers can trace any binary back to source. Verify provenance by comparing the artifact stamp against the token recorded below.

build token for kagaf-hahof: htk14_9d3d4d26d7d8de

**Ticket: QRX-health checks failing after broker upgrade**

Quick one for the weekly sync: the Hollowpine staging broker got bumped from Quillmq 3.x to 4.1 on Tuesday, but nobody updated the env file, so the consumers are still trying the old vhost and plaintext port. I've fixed `QUILLMQ_HOST` and `QUILLMQ_VHOST` and flipped TLS on. The last missing piece is the broker credential that 4.1 requires for the management channel — add it right below this line in staging's env file.

sealed setting: VAULT_KEY5=0924b